Output e9615b28fafbd5bf86b42545be0551160a5915cc83f2bd0175f8a7219d292e9c:0

value
7841309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a9bc7e01e1a05f4a1f7b71eb65032b57e40a26 OP_EQUAL
address
3QT7Wo26t5gBQPjLqibyWSSWvhYyJ6L1dm
transaction
e9615b28fafbd5bf86b42545be0551160a5915cc83f2bd0175f8a7219d292e9c